FCTA Seals PDP National Office, FIRS, Others Over Ground Rent Default

By Joyce Remi-Babayeju

The Federal Capital Territory Administration, FCTA, on Monday wielded the big stick as it sealed up some properties including the PDP National Secretariat Headquarters, the Federal Internal Revenue Service ,FFIRS, Total Energy at Wuse and Access Bank building over non-payment of 25 years ground rent.

Director of Lands in FCTA, Mr Chijioke Nwakwoeze who lead the enforcement team, said that the affected properties sealed up have been taken over and now belong to the Administration.

Recall that on Friday last week FCTA announced that the administration on Monday 26 , May 2025 will commence sealing and taking over 4, 796 properties over non-payment of ground rent from ten to 25 years and above.

Nwakwoeze stated that the FIRS building, located in Wuse Zone 5, owed the FCTA ground rent for 25 years.
” Access Bank building, on Plot No. 2456, Wuse I, Cadastral Zone A02, Abuja, belong to Rana Tahir Furniture Nig. Ltd, and had not paid ground rent for 34 years”, he explained.

He said that by this the property has been reverted and therefore now belongs to the FCTA who has taken possession of it.

The Director Development Control, Mr Mukhtar Galadima, noted that the exercise is to take possession of all properties revoked in March.

Galadima also recounted FCTA’s decision to take possession of the more than 4,000 revoked properties in the territory.

He said, “So, today is just to comply with what we have said that we are going to take over all the revoked properties, and we are starting with plot 534 cadastral zone A02 at Wuse Zone 1, owned by Total PLC.”
